We watched a monarch emerge from its chyrsalis today at school. It waited until 9:05 just in time for all of us to see. It was in Mrs. Thomson's backyard this Aug.
We are setting it free this afternoon. We know it is a female because it doesn't have any scent glands and the lines are thicker.
